Output 63af929d370606fa3ad54f233f11304e4471f4b8a1b25d9a5f50a79cb0fab0ad:21

value
12322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d860a5c7652d318ca4fbcb82933d5ef852212b20 OP_EQUAL
address
3MR7fAq4XGKpFgrqiDXo626tfJD6A8FVhT
transaction
63af929d370606fa3ad54f233f11304e4471f4b8a1b25d9a5f50a79cb0fab0ad
spent
true